The locals eat here or pick up their food. In addition to a large counter with specialty cheese, cream and salads, there is a large selection of inexpensive breakfast options with and without eggs - vegetarian or not. All around $7.50 plus $5 for a specialty coffee. The atmosphere is not particularly cozy as there are many people waiting inside for their food; and everything comes in an aluminum box - but unfortunately that's pretty normal here. But the food is fresh and deliciously prepared.
